    By far our favorite hotel throughout our two week vacation in France. Le Dortoir is located in…read morecentral Nice, next to lively restaurants, shopping, and a short five minute walk to the beach. I booked directly on the Le Dortoir website which guaranteed the best rates. If you book directly with them, reminder to be aware of conversation rates and foreign transaction fees since they do not have the option to book in USD. When we arrived, our room was ready and we were promptly greeted by their staff who also helped carry our luggage with us to the second floor. I believe Le Dortoir has their rooms on the second, third, and fourth floor of the building but you have to climb three sets of stairs to get to the second floor since the ground floor starts on floor 0. There is no elevator which is probably the only con. The rooms are just as pictured. Super modern, clean, and spacious. We loved the hardwood floors, rain shower, and natural lighting which came in from three large windows that spanned the entire side of the room. We booked a room with a balcony which we highly recommend as that was probably our favorite part of the room. Located in a bustling area of Nice, the balcony overlooked the town center and provided a fun area to relax, unwind, and people-watch after a long day of exploring Nice. The room includes a mini fridge, Nespresso machine and wine opener/drinking glasses. The only strange thing was that housekeeping came into our room even when we had the "Do not disturb" sign on. We thought we had forgotten to put the sign up the first day, but even after checking the second and third day, they continued to come in. We had no issues with our stuff and didn't feel the need to make a compliant but we did think that was a bit strange. They have staff in their office located on the "ground floor" (one set of stairs from the entrance) during working hours if you have questions during your stay. Overall, we had a wonderful stay here and would definitely come back next time we are in Nice.

    After spending a few days In Antibes, we decided to head east towards Melton. Since Nice is on our…read morepath, we decided to spend a day here. Checking the area, we found this hotel right next to the train station. The proximity to the major sights was too good to pass and the price for the room was really reasonable. The path to the hotel from the train station is very easy. Take a right out of the station and the hotel is located right on the next bloc. Escalators will take you to the lobby upstairs. Walk through the lobby door.... and here you are! The staff was super friendly and even though we arrived very early.... around 11 am.... they got us a room. I understand that European stand is an afternoon check in. But most hotel have been very accommodating. The bar looked very inviting and the path to the room easy. Remember European standard for sizes. If you are used to travel with large American size bags, the elevators and rooms are fairly small. So, you will have an issue.... trust me! We got to the room and it s a simple format with no amenities. There s a shower gel for the shower and sink soap. There are no tissue box or coffee/ tea station. This hotel has a small pool on the first floor and no gym. I understand they offer a nice breakfast buffet but we would rather find a nice bakery on the way to the sights.

    We were taking a relaxing walking holiday going from La Brige in the Roya Valley down to the coast…read moreat Menton on the cote d'Azur. Of all the places we stayed, Villa Amiel in Sospel stands head and shoulders above the rest in terms of size and quality of the rooms, breakfast, setting, but more because of the super welcome we got from the proprietors Patrick and Mark. When we arrived we got offered a welcoming drink and they also took the time to chat with us - telling us about the places to visit in and around the village such as the old Maginot line forts and the old chapels in the village. Mark has a wealth of information about great walks in the valley and beyond and his descriptions are spot on too. Come the evening when we wanted to know where to eat they also gave us absolutely honest recommendation for the restaurants (which they booked for us too) Needless to say the food was excellent! (la Mordagne and Relais du Sel) In fact we were so taken by the way we were treated, we stayed another night and frankly we would have stayed longer but they were fully booked after that. But the courtesy and service did not end there. We were going on towards Menton via Castilar but Mark suggested we went by St Agnes and stayed there overnight instead. Again they recommended we stayed and ate at the hotel St Yves (Good food, reasonable accommodation) and then took a route down to Menton that passed by the old town of Roquebrune and even told of a a great place to stay in Menton as well. All in all, our whole holiday was greatly enriched by our stay in Sospel and at Villa Amiel in particular. There is so much we would have missed if we had not met Patrick and Mark. Oh, and one last thing. When we can to pay our bill, the welcome drinks we got on arrival we not included - they were free - which was really quite a nice touch.

    The b&b is close enouhg to the train station and he does have directions up I her website. So ifyou…read morefollow them directly you cannot get lost! The rooms are on the second floor and I stayed in the orange room. I thought my stay was ok, since it was so hot in Nice I did want to use the AC the whole time I was on my room including sleeping. But she does tell you not to do that, which I did not like but she does live there. ISo if you are picky and need the AC on while you're in your room, don't stay here then! But I was ok with this rule. The room has its own refrigerator and she gives you water! First time I had free water at any hotel in Europe haha! I didn't like how she told us to help clean up the bathroom. I understand her reason but I just didn't think with the price you pay, that you should have to do anything. You have to wipe down the shower after you use it because she doesn't have a strong enough vent in the room. So to prevent mold, we the customers, have to wipe it down. Breakfast could have been way more..... I left all the mornings hungry! She puts fresh croissants in the oven and gives us jam and butter. Then there's a loaf of bread and tea and yogurt and oj available. That's it. There is a market across the way by the train station so stock up! She has her cool dog Rocco so if you have allergies, stay away, but he's a cool and chill dog. Overall, I had an ok experience. She lets you borrow a mat and towel for the pebble beaches so take advantage! But I probably wouldn't go back again. Only to try other places and a different location in Nice but it wasn't a super great experience.

    I stayed here in late May with a friend in the green room. We had a good experience, but there was…read moreroom for improvement. As expressed, the experience is very much like staying in someone's home and that comes with its pros and cons. The location was excellent for site seeing and beach going. Josephine has plenty of recommendations for both rainy and sunny days, both of which we took full advantage! She has a bookshelf of guidebooks and other tourist information for you to borrow and gave us a map on our first day which was great. Wifi is free, which also helped with planning our stay. She has a really cute dog, Rocco, who helped me cope with my homesick feelings for my own dogs. I would agree that if you don't like dogs, you shouldn't stay here. I personally found having him here a major perk to a homey experience! I also agree with other reviews that I expected more from breakfast, although not in quantity but in variety. She gives more than enough food to be full all morning! Breakfast consists of fresh croissants, yogurt, OJ, tea/coffee, and assorted breads with various spreads and jams. I think it would be nice if there were a few fruits in addition. Since we stayed for several days, it would have been nice not to be eating mainly bread every morning (although delicious!) It seemed that Josephine was a bit judgmental of the guests' decisions and eating habits which was unpleasant. She made comments to my friend and me about the length of other guest's showers, made disgusted faces at our sausage and other pork products we got from the market, and made an unnecessary amount of comments in regard to money. It seemed like she felt obligated to sit with us during the entirety of breakfast, which felt a bit awkward and forced. For the price and location, I think this was a good place but I would probably try something else if I return to Nice.
